2013-04-10 24 views
0

我试图用一些CSS来定制的HTML5输入类型=种类的标签,所以到目前为止,我已经使用WebKit的取得了一句:创建自定义的输入类型范围的跨浏览器

div#timeline input[type="range"] { 
    -webkit-appearance: none; 
    background-color: darkgray; 
    height: 2px; 
     border-right: black solid 4px; 
     border-left: black solid 4px; 
} 

div#timeline input[type="range"]::-webkit-slider-thumb { 
    -webkit-appearance: none; 
    position: relative; 
    top: 0px; 
    z-index: 1; 
    width: 16px; 
    height: 8px; 
    background: #696060; 
} 

但是好像这仅适用于Chrome,是否可以制作自定义滑块,以便每个浏览器都相同? 我正在考虑制作一些能够模拟输入范围行为的东西,但是我在网上找不到任何东西,而且我用JavaScript和东西很新。

回答

0

您可以尝试使用一些JavaScript库,如jQueryUI或jQueryTools 。最后一个具有非常简单的演示:

http://jquerytools.org/release-notes/index.html#form

Unfortunaly输入范围不能与只是纯粹的CSS跨浏览器的方式,现在的风格,我们需要等待多一点点。

+0

谢谢我使用jquery ui。在任何浏览器上定制和工作都很容易 – Pievis 2013-04-13 21:00:50

相关问题